Lockfree list
WitrynaList otwarty – tekst interwencyjny napisany przez autora (lub sygnatariuszy) w formie bezpośredniej do jednej osoby lub szerszego grona odbiorców, podany do publicznej … Witryna11 kwi 2024 · You should now be able to select some text and right-click to Copy . If you still can't select text, click any blank area in the page, press Ctrl + A (PC) or Cmd + A (Mac) to select all, then Ctrl + C (PC) or Cmd + C (Mac) to copy. Open a document or text file, and then paste the copied items into that document.
Lockfree list
Did you know?
Witryna28 lut 2024 · Which enables assigning a destructor function to the key. This way, arbitrary local storage can be assigned by mmap-ing and storing the pointer, and then munmap-ing in the destructor.. There is of course another way, and that is to use a lock-free hash-table.. And as there is no easy way to describe how lock-free hash-tables work, I will … Witryna18 mar 2014 · В предыдущих своих заметках я описал основу, на которой строятся lock-free структуры данных, и базовые алгоритмы управления временем жизни элементов lock-free структур данных. Это была прелюдия к …
Witrynakevinlynx/lockfree-list.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. master. Switch branches/tags. Branches Tags. Could not load branches. Nothing to show {{ refName }} default View all branches. Could not load tags. Nothing to show Witryna28 lut 2024 · Which enables assigning a destructor function to the key. This way, arbitrary local storage can be assigned by mmap-ing and storing the pointer, and then …
Witryna18 lis 2024 · A crate providing lock-free data structures and a solution for the "ABA problem" related to pointers. The incinerator is the API which tries to solve the "ABA problem" when related to pointer dropping. With incinerator, every thread has a local garbage list. Dropping a shared object consist of first removing the pointer from the … Witryna1 dzień temu · This function finds right spot at the list and tries to add a new node. When I start program with mpiexec -n 1 everything works fine, but when I start it with -n > 2 …
Witryna30 kwi 2013 · The source code for my ConcurrentList class is available on GitHub. It is lock-free, thread-safe (I think, based on my unit tests), and implements IList. It …
Witryna4 cze 2015 · Simple lockfree IPC using shared memory and C11. Jun 4, 2015. I have an interesting Linux application that requires a process with one or more real-time threads to communicate with other processes on the system. The use case is single producer with single consumer per IPC channel. The real-time requirements of the … how to login to fortnite on nintendo switchWitrynaLock Free Linked List Based On Harris'OrderedListBasedSet And Michael's Hazard Pointer. Feature. Thread-safe and Lock-free. ABA safe. Set implemented through … how to log in to frontier emailWitrynaLockfree Linked Lists and Skip Lists . Split-Ordered Lists: Lockfree Extensible Hash Tables (ACM, slides). Very interesting lockfree hash table. It uses recursive split-ordering technique. Works on top of any singly linked list. Requires only single word CAS. Requires some kind of PDR. Includes full source and implementation of … jos-tech plasticsWitrynanamespace lockfree {// / Lock-free doubly-linked list /* * * Based on the paper: "Lock-free deques and doubly linked lists", Sundell, et al. - 2008 * * \tparam T Container element type * \tparam Alloc_ Allocator for elements, should be lock-free. If using MemPool then ensure it has a bucket large enough to hold List::Node. jost convertible fifth wheelWitryna9 lut 2014 · The doubly linked list is lock-free because an announced operation makes progress by attempting CAS operations. A successful CAS takes the operation one … how to log into frontier routerWitrynaHere's the timing and memory allocation data comparison between the lockfree map, sync.Map and golang's map + RWMutex: The lockfree hashmap is 3x as fast as … how to login to fortnite on pcWitryna12 kwi 2024 · 1. Split-ordered lists: lock-free extensible hash tables O.Shalev and N.Shavit. In Journal of the ACM, 53 (3):379-405,NY,USA,2006, ACM Press 論文紹介 M1 熊崎宏樹. 2. 概要 複数のスレッドから並列にアクセスしても構造 が破壊されないハッシュテーブル ロックを用いず高いスケーラビリティを ... jos-tech inc